Released on October 22, 2012 Red (Deluxe Version) is the expanded edition of Taylor Swift's fourth studio album. It is famously described by Swift as her "only true breakup album," capturing the "messy," "tumultuous," and "intense" emotions associated with the color red. The Deluxe Features While the standard album has 16 tracks, the Deluxe Version 6 additional tracks that provide deeper insight into the era: "The Moment I Knew" : A heartbreaking ballad about her 21st birthday party.
